OYSTER aims to improve the understanding and measurement of adhesion in materials by linking nanoscale data to larger-scale applications. The project focuses on developing standardized methodologies and tools to enhance product performance and reduce costs in various industries.
A failure to quantitatively control adhesion costs billions of euros each year in failed components, suboptimal product performance and life-threatening infections.
Nano-enabled and bio-inspired products offer practical solutions to overcome adhesion and friction problems in these application areas.
